Today, the name of James Tufenkian is the synonym for beautiful carpets and the most important of all the symbol for the charity work. After he finished law school, Tufenkian took a trip to Nepal where he met Tsetan Gyurman, Tibetian emigrate and master weaver who produced the finest and most beautiful carpets in his atelier. What started as an accidental meeting turned to be a deep friendship, and friendship arose to the partnership.
In 1986 James Tufenkian employed 100 workers and founded Tufenkian Artisan carpets in New York. In 1993 he expanded his business to Armenia, the country where he was born. In 1995 he opened a medical centre in Nepal to provide modern medicine to its employees, and the year later he launched a collection of exclusive design carpets.
For most people that will be enough considered that he lived in metropolis New York, million miles away from south Asia. But, that was just the beginning of its plans. The Tufenkian Foundation began to work in 1999 with goal to benefit people in Armenia and Nepal. In 2001 he introduced Armenia's first luxury boutique hotel and soon after that two more hotels to help Armenia to become not just lovely but also a stylish tourist destination.
